Product details
- Tasting Notes: Expect rich black fruits (Bing cherry, raspberry), baking spices, cracked pepper, black tea, orange peel, soy, and saline notes, with a focused, silky, and structured palate.
- Structure: Medium to full-bodied with harmonious oak, vibrant acidity, fine tannins, and a long finish, indicating great aging potential.
- Aging: Recommended to cellar for a year or two for integration, with potential to drink well through 2035.
- Scores: Achieved high scores, including 96 points from Wine Spectrum and 95 from The Wine Advocate, with mentions of powerful yet balanced complexity.
